This movie has a rather prosaic title, viz “Mera Ghar Mere Bachche” (1960) and the actors of this movie are not all that well known. In fact the picturisation of this song had me confused. This song is a duet and the gentleman in the picturisation looked like he was apeing N T Ramarao, the telugu movie superstar of the time, whereas the lady looked like an aspiring body double of Vyjyanti Mala. Now I know that she is Naaz, also known as Baby Naaz. (I thank Mr Harshad Bhatt for helping me out with her identification). The gentleman is Subiraj.

Bollywood romantic songs are reputed to be sung while running around trees. But how do the hero and heroine reach there in the first place ? In case they are rich, they have a car to reach there, but there is nothing romantic in that. It is far more romantic when the hero is driving a motor bike and the lady seated behind is clinging on to him with her arms strategically placed on hero’s body.
